Governor Ahmed, others bag JCI awards

Date: 2014-02-17

The Kwara State Governor, Alhaji Abdulfatah Ahmed at the weekend bagged the outstanding person award of 'Most Youth Development Ambassador' conferred on him by Junior Chamber International (JCI).

The award presentation which also featured the installation of Comrade Kazeem Adekanye as 2014 President of JCI in Kwara State was held at the Kwara Hotel, Ilorin,  weekend.
Other individuals and corporate organizations also conferred with various awards by JCI included the Kwara State First Lady's pet project, 'LEAH Charity Foundation' as the Most Impactfull Organization; MD/CEO GANZY Global Nig Ltd, Alhaji Abdulganiyu Zubair as Ambassador of Positive Change; the General Manager Kwara United, Alhaji Mohammed Haruna Maigidasanma as Grass Root Sports Development Ambassador; Mr Femi Adetola (also known as Dr FA) as Pillar of the Youth: Harmony Holding Ltd as Most Innovative Corporate Organization and MD/CEO of FEMTECH, Mr Emmanuel Olufemi Abidoye as IT Person of the year.

Speaking during the award ceremony, the state Governor, Alhaji Abdulfatah Ahmed said the award would spur him to do more and consolidate on various youth oriented programmes of his administration.
Governor Ahmed who was represented at the occasion by his Special Adviser on Communication Strategy, Alhaji AbdulRaheem Adedoyin commended the JCI for its various community-based projects and programmes that have been really assisting government in no small measure.

Ahmed who expressed satisfaction over the recognition of his administration's performance  by the JCI, pledged his government's continuous support and assistance to the JCI so as to enable it achieve its sole aim of impacting meaningfully to the community within which it operates.

The Governor promised that his administration would do everything possible to evolve policies and programmes that would turn around the lives of the youths in the state.

In his lecture at the occasion, the guest speaker, Mr Oyetunji Obafemi who spoke on "Entrepreneurship Development Key To Economic Prosperity" advised Nigerian youth to develop interest in entrepreneurial skill describing it as best alternative to white cola job.

Obafemi who affirmed that white cola job is not easy to come by in the present situation, said the earlier we embrace the entrepreneurial  and vocational skills in Nigeria the better for the economic prosperity of this nation.

In his address, the newly installed President of JCI-Kwara, Comrade Kazeem Adekanye said the choice of Governor Ahmed as recipient of the JCI award was not unconnected with the governor's frantic efforts in empowering teeming kwaran youths using KWABES and Quick Win strategies as platforms.

Adekanye said the award of all recipients was on the basis of their selfless services to humanity in all their various fields.

He called on members of JCI-kwara to join hands with him and speak with one voice in order to accomplish all their desired aims and objectives lined up for the good people of Kwara, especially youth.
